Changed defaults in Splitfork, our assignment service. Bucketing now uses sticky hashing per account instead of per session, and the holdout slice grew from 2% to 5%. Callers relying on session-level reassignment must opt in explicitly. Review the diff against the new baseline; the updated default configuration is listed below.

config for tagep-kajof:
[casir]
port = 6379
region = south-1
host = casir.paliqdyn.example
team = tamax
timeout_ms = 250
retries = 2

Runbook: account recovery during queue migration (for plugin authors)

The legacy Thornbury job queue is being replaced by Larkspool. During cutover, plugin accounts tied to the old queue may lock out. Recovery steps: stop your worker, clear cached queue tokens, re-register against the Larkspool endpoint, and confirm your plugin appears in the consumer list. Do not re-enqueue stalled jobs manually; the migrator handles replay. The recovery console prompts once; enter the passphrase below.

vault phrase of kawep-tahog = ulaix-briath

Team,

The RenderMill transcoding farm completed its cut-over to the Quarrystone cluster at 02:10 local time. All in-flight jobs were drained beforehand, and the queue replayed cleanly with no dropped segments. Expect tickets referencing the old hostnames for a week or so; please redirect users to the new intake endpoint. Rollback remains possible until Friday. So you can verify customer-reported settings against what is actually deployed, the current production configuration is as follows:

deployment values, kajep-kageg:
[praix]
host = praix.paliqcorp.corp
user = praix_svc
database = praix_prod

## Connection Pooling

The Larkmere order service holds its pool open across deploys, so draining must happen before any schema change. Pool exhaustion has historically shown up as intermittent 502s rather than clean errors, which is why we alert on checkout wait time, not just pool size. If you tune anything, change one parameter at a time and watch the saturation dashboard for a full hour. The current production settings are as follows.

config for tagep-yajef:
ulawyn:
  log_level: error
  metrics_host: metrics.ulawyn.lumiclabs.internal
  pin: 0564
  pool_size: 32